9 wards prone to water-borne diseases

Mumbai, June 15 (UNI) The BMC health department has identified nine wards that are vulnerable to water-borne diseases.

The Sion hospital, the Nair hospital and the KEM hospital have made special arrangements for treating such patients.

Additional municipal commissioner (health and education) Kishore Gajbhiye told reporters, ''We have created 25 health-posts in the city that have been well equipped.'' He added that 50 additional beds will be arranged in each hospital during the monsoons for the benefit of patients suffering from water-borne diseases. All BMC hospitals are well stocked with medicines and other requirements, he said.

The BMC will take the help of the Indian Medical Association and the Nursing Association during the monsoons to prevent any kind of epidemic outbreak and spread of diseases, he added.
